为了账号安全,请及时绑定邮箱和手机立即绑定

Tkinter 按钮未在我的 mac 上显示文本,尽管代码可在其他计算机上运行

Tkinter 按钮未在我的 mac 上显示文本,尽管代码可在其他计算机上运行

心有法竹 2021-07-29 18:25:51
我有一个功能代码,除非我单击并按住按钮,否则不会在按钮上显示文本。当释放按钮的文本再次变为空白。我试过在其他论坛上解决这个问题请注意:代码本身没有任何问题。我的笔记本电脑运行代码的方式存在某种问题。我试过重新安装python3.7以及tcl-tk。我真的不知道还能做什么。
查看完整描述

2 回答

?
凤凰求蛊

TA贡献1825条经验 获得超4个赞

这是添加此行的解决方案from tkinter import ttk。


而不是ttk.在任何地方都可以使用按钮、标签、条目等:


ttk .Button(text="Login", width="30", command = login).pack()


这是代码,因此您可以尝试一下。


def main_screen():

  from tkinter import ttk


  global screen

  screen = Tk()


  screen.geometry("500x500")

  screen.title("4rManager")


  Label(text="Login/Register", font=("Calibri", 13)).pack()

  ttk.Label(text="").pack()

  ttk.Button(text="Login").pack()

  ttk.Label(text="").pack()

  ttk.Button(text="Register").pack()


  screen.mainloop()


main_screen()

希望我有所帮助。


查看完整回答
反对 回复 2021-08-03
  • 2 回答
  • 0 关注
  • 138 浏览
慕课专栏
更多

添加回答

举报

0/150
提交
取消
微信客服

购课补贴
联系客服咨询优惠详情

帮助反馈 APP下载

慕课网APP
您的移动学习伙伴

公众号

扫描二维码
关注慕课网微信公众号